well I cant speak about suspensin upgrades because I didnt do any on my 250.....But at 210 or so I can see it as something you should consider. Stiffer springs up front will help with the dive along with thicker oil. (might wana try the oil first 15W if i recall) The rear should be ok as its adjustable (a little anyway) If your not tracking the bike and you think its ok in the twistys for now I would put it near the bottom of the list. if and when you swap springs thats when the emulators come into play.
